A political controversy has erupted after Leader of Opposition in Lok Sabha Rahul Gandhi was handed over a driving license, said to be that of his grandfather Firoz Gandhi, during his visit to his parliamentary constituency Rae Bareli in Uttar Pradesh on Tuesday. Dinesh Pratap Singh, Minister of State (Independent Charge) in the Yogi government, has raised questions on the validity of this driving license and demanded an investigation.
Rahul Gandhi was on a tour of his parliamentary constituency Rae Bareli. On the second day of the tour, a person named Vikas Singh, associated with the organizing board of Rae Bareli Premier League, handed him this driving license. Vikas Singh claims that this license was suddenly given to his father-in-law during a program years ago. After this, his father-in-law and then mother-in-law kept it safe and now it was handed over to Rahul Gandhi.
Dinesh Pratap Singh asked- How did this document come?
However, Minister of State Dinesh Pratap Singh has raised serious questions on this entire incident. He said that any personal document coming out like this raises suspicion. Dinesh Singh demanded that it should be investigated whether the driving license is genuine and valid or not, and it should also be clarified how this document came into the possession of the person who handed it over.
Dinesh Pratap Singh said, ‘Driving license is the personal property of a person, which should generally be with his family or heirs. How this license reached another person is a matter of serious investigation. He also expressed apprehension whether this issue was deliberately raised to make Rahul Gandhi’s Rae Bareli visit an ‘event’.

Along with this, the Minister of State also targeted Rahul Gandhi through a Facebook post. He wrote whether this issue has been raised to mislead the people of Rae Bareli and to gain cheap popularity. In the post, he also questioned that if this license was found in someone’s house, then why was it not returned to the heirs for so many years and whether this document is legally made or fake.
At the same time, Rahul Gandhi became emotional after getting his grandfather’s driving license and he immediately informed his mother Sonia Gandhi about it through WhatsApp. Rahul Gandhi also thanked Vikas Singh from the stage who handed over the license.
The driving license that Rahul Gandhi has received from his grandfather was issued 88 years ago i.e. in 1938. Now it remains to be seen what will be the stand on Dinesh Pratap Singh’s demand after 88 years.
